Air India and Air India Express Add 166 Extra Flights to Patna for Diwali and Chhath 2025 Travel Rush

In preparation for the Diwali and Chhath Puja travel rush, Air India (AI) and Air India Express have announced a major expansion plan, adding 166 additional weekly flights to and from Patna. The move is aimed at enhancing connectivity and managing passenger demand during one of India’s busiest travel periods.

The expansion will be carried out in two phases — with Air India operating 114 additional flights between October 15 and November 2, 2025, followed by Air India Express running 52 extra flights between October 22 and November 3, 2025.

Flight Expansion Details: Major Boost to Bihar Connectivity

Under this festive expansion, Air India will operate additional flights on three major domestic routes:

  • 38 extra flights each on Delhi–Patna, Mumbai–Patna, and Bengaluru–Patna routes.

Meanwhile, Air India Express will strengthen its network with 26 additional flights each on Delhi–Patna and Bengaluru–Patna routes.

These special festive services are designed to supplement existing flights rather than replace them. Currently, Air India operates 42 weekly flights between Delhi, Mumbai, and Patna, while Air India Express runs 14 weekly flights connecting Delhi and Bengaluru with Patna.

This move marks one of the largest single-state seasonal capacity boosts by any airline group in recent years, according to travel industry experts.

Purpose: Meeting the Festive Rush and Election Travel Demand

The primary goal of the expanded flight schedule is to meet the surge in festive travel demand, enabling smoother homeward journeys for thousands of passengers heading to Bihar for Diwali and Chhath Puja.

Additionally, the increased connectivity aligns with the upcoming Bihar state assembly elections, which are expected to further intensify travel activity in the region.

Industry Response and Broader Festive Trends

The festive travel season in India traditionally sees a sharp spike in passenger traffic, and airlines across the country are responding with capacity expansions. Along with Air India and Air India Express, other carriers have also announced special flights to Patna from cities such as Bengaluru, Ahmedabad, and Hyderabad, underscoring the growing demand for domestic air travel during festivals.
